// Fixture: perf_template_render_baseline
// This fixture benchmarks the Quillstone template engine against a
// 200-partial layout to catch regressions above the 45ms p95 budget.
// If this test flakes on-call, check the warm-cache flag first; cold
// starts inflate timings by roughly 3x and are expected. The fixture
// pulls reference templates from the staging render service, which
// requires authentication. Use the bearer token below.

session JWT of yawep-yawep = eyJhbGciOiJIUzI1NiIsInR5cCI6IkpXVCJ9.eyJzdWIiOiI3pWF3_In0.aXYsHiog

- [ ] Ceremony step 4 — Marlowe Report Builder: confirm sort stability before key material is exported. Run the audit report twice with identical filters; row order must match byte-for-byte, since the signing manifest hashes the sorted output. Flag any nondeterminism in the weekly eng sync notes before proceeding. When both runs match, the ceremony host may open the escrow envelope using the passphrase given directly below.

recovery phrase for bawep-kawef: oliath-casdor

- [ ] Step 7: Archive cold storage buckets (Glacierline tier). Confirm both ceremony witnesses are present, verify bucket manifests match the Oxbow ledger, then seal the archive key shares. Plugin authors may observe but not handle shares. Once sealed, the archive index itself is encrypted and can only be reopened with the passphrase below.

vault phrase of badup-hahig = tamael-aldael-kelmir-istael-fenok-istwyn-tamius-jorath-oliion